Volunteers are needed to work the polls at the Nov. 4 General Election in Forsyth County.

County residents who are at least 16 years old and a citizen of the United States may attend an informational "meet and greet" session to learn more.

Sessions are scheduled for 2 p.m. and 6:30 p.m. Thursday and 10 a.m. and 2:30 p.m. Sept. 3.

Because there are a limited number of seats at each meeting, those interested must RSVP to learn the meeting location. Contact Betsy Brown at (770) 781-2118, Ext. 3, or bmbrown@forsythco.com.

The election will be the fourth this year, following the Feb. 5 presidential preference, July 15 primary and Aug. 5 primary runoff elections.

In addition to the presidential race, the fall election will feature contests for many key offices, including U.S. Senate and House as well as state posts.

Locally, the ballot will feature contests for one seat each on the Forsyth County commission and school board.

Also, there are two bond referendums, one to fund construction of a new detention center and the other for a new sheriff's headquarters.
